§ 3-29-12 — Local administration of association; board of directors

A. The local administration of the association and the operation and maintenance of the project shall be carried out in each community by a board of directors composed of an odd number of at least three members. Members of the board of directors shall:
(1)be elected annually or as specified in the bylaws of the association;
(2)be members in good standing of the association; and (3) serve staggered terms of up to four years to ensure that terms will end in different election years. B. The board of directors shall choose among its members a president, a vice president and a secretary-treasurer or a secretary and a treasurer. C.
